Latest Collection
The "Escape from MDS" collection represents the journey of individuals facing insufficiency, portraying emotions and inner conflicts. Inspired by a true story progressing from myelodysplastic syndrome to acute leukemia, this collection sheds light on the struggle and transformation stemming from bone marrow's inability to produce enough blood cells or form normal structures. By reflecting the effects of myelodisplastic syndrome, it underscores themes of resilience and metamorphosis.
The collection aims to convey a powerful message to the audience, showcasing the inner strength and endurance of the human spirit, urging action to escape the potential consequences of the disease. Additionally, it seeks to raise awareness about diseases such as myelodysplastic syndrome and leukemia.
Each texture and fabric manipulation reflects signs of life and the inherent battle within. Utilizing manipulated fabrics and knitted threads, the pieces illustrate the workings of the disease within the body. For instance, wrinkles on organic cotton symbolize bone abnormalities, while the purple processing draws inspiration from the microscopic appearance of cells.
